Subject: [PATCH 02/21] ls_colors.c: parse color.ls.* from config file
Date: Sun, 25 Jan 2015 19:37:37 +0700	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<1422189476-7518-3-git-send-email-pclouds@gmail.com>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<1422189476-7518-1-git-send-email-pclouds@gmail.com>

This is the second (and preferred) source for color information. This
will override $LS_COLORS.

+color.ls.<slot>::
+	Use customized color for file name colorization. If not set
+	and the environment variable LS_COLORS is set, color settings
+	from $LS_COLORS are used. `<slot>` can be `normal`, `file`,
+	`directory`, `symlink`, `fifo`, `socket`, `block`, `char`,
+	`missing`, `orphan`, `executable`, `door`, `setuid`, `setgid`,
+	`sticky`, `otherwritable`, `stickyotherwritable`, `cap`,
+	`multihardlink`. The values of these variables may be
+	specified as in color.branch.<slot>.

+static int ls_colors_config(const char *var, const char *value, void *cb)
+{
+	int slot;
+	if (!starts_with(var, "color.ls."))
+		return 0;
+	var += 9;
+	for (slot = 0; config_name[slot]; slot++)
+		if (!strcasecmp(var, config_name[slot]))
+			break;
+	if (!config_name[slot])
+		return 0;
+	if (!value)
+		return config_error_nonbool(var);
+	color_parse(value, ls_colors[slot]);
+	return 0;
+}
